In this episode, we will discuss NULLs in database systems. I’ll go through the following:
What is Null?
NULLs persistence
Whether you store a 0 or 2 billion value in the field 32bit integer field it costs 32 bit
when you store a NULL in 32 bit integer field we save 32 bit but add overheads
When NULLs are naughty
Semantics and inconsistent result
Select count(*). Includes nulls
count(column) ignores nulls
T is NULL returns the null rows
T is NOT NULL returns not null rows
T In (NULL) returns nothing
T not in NULL returns nothing
Some database don’t index nulls
When NULLs are useful
I don’t have value , I don’t wish to provide a birthday
not applicable field for certain use cases but not others fat tables (denormlization)
Fat tables with many columns makes your rows longer which means fewer rows fit in your page (show pic).. NULLs help here .. that are NULL, it yields shorter rows, instead of storing a default 0 value
